  • Publication number: 20100257623
    Abstract: Rice plants are disclosed with multiple sources of resistance to herbicides that normally inhibit a plant's acetohydroxyacid synthase (AHAS) enzyme. Besides controlling red rice, many AHAS-inhibiting herbicides also effectively control other weeds that are common in rice fields. Several of these herbicides have residual activity, so that one treatment can control both existing weeds and weeds that sprout later. With effective residual activity against red rice and other weeds, rice producers now have a weed control system superior to those that are currently available commercially.

  • Publication number: 20090018019
    Abstract: A method of increasing the inherent defense mechanisms of plants by treating them with chloronicotinyls is disclosed. Chloronicotinyls produce, independently of their control of insects, effective protection of plants against damage from fungal, bacterial or viral pathogens. This defense against pathogens is obtained by the induction of PR proteins resulting from treatment with at least one chloronicotinyl.
